Du bist nicht angemeldet. Der Zugriff auf einige Boards wurde daher deaktiviert.

#1 03. Mai 2019 08:13

antibart
Server-Pate
Registriert: 14. Dezember 2010
Beiträge: 880

[G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

Hi alle,

in LISE gibt es den Feldtypen "Inhaltsseiten", der eine Auswahlliste aller CMS-Seiten ausgibt.

Ich möchte dieses Feld nutzen, um in einer Übersichtsseite Links zu bestehenden Seiten zu erstellen.

Das funktioniert auch gut. Wermutstropfen ist lediglich, dass der Feldtyp die Seiten-ID verwendet. Dadurch sieht der Link folgendermaßen aus:

domain.de/3   

Für SEO ist das ungünstig. Besser wäre, man könnte das so hinbiegen, dass der Seiten-Alias verwendet wird bzw. dahin weiterleitet.

Ist sowas möglich? Also automatisiert, nicht manuell über .htacces oder so.

Beitrag geändert von antibart (03. Mai 2019 08:15)

Offline

#2 03. Mai 2019 09:40

nockenfell
Moderator
Ort: Gontenschwil, Schweiz
Registriert: 09. November 2010
Beiträge: 2.934
Webseite

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

Kannst du die Seiten-Id nicht über den {cms_selflink} Tag als URL ausgeben lassen. Ich meinte man kann dem Tag ein Alias oder eine Seiten-Id übergeben.


[dieser Beitrag wurde mit 100% recycled bits geschrieben]
Mein Blog  /   Diverse Links rund um CMS Made Simple
Module: btAdminer, ToolBox

Offline

#3 03. Mai 2019 09:52

antibart
Server-Pate
Registriert: 14. Dezember 2010
Beiträge: 880

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

nockenfell schrieb:

Kannst du die Seiten-Id nicht über den {cms_selflink} Tag als URL ausgeben lassen. Ich meinte man kann dem Tag ein Alias oder eine Seiten-Id übergeben.

In die Richtung ging auch mein erster Ansatz. Aber das Problem ist ja, dass der Feldtyp "Inhaltsseiten" eben keinen Alias ausgibt, sondern nur ID. Der Parameter page ="alias oder ID" nützt mir also nichts, da ich ja keine Wahl habe.

Beitrag geändert von antibart (03. Mai 2019 11:30)

Offline

#4 03. Mai 2019 13:59

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

nockenfell schrieb:

Kannst du die Seiten-Id nicht über den {cms_selflink} Tag als URL ausgeben lassen. Ich meinte man kann dem Tag ein Alias oder eine Seiten-Id übergeben.

Schau mal in dein Toolbar Modul. Hab zwar gerade nix zum Nachlesen, aber gibt es da nicht ein get_page_alias, bei dem man die Seiten ID übergibt wink ?

Offline

#5 03. Mai 2019 14:02

Andynium
Moderator
Ort: Dohna / SN / Deutschland
Registriert: 13. September 2010
Beiträge: 7.018
Webseite

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

antibart schrieb:

Der Parameter page ="alias oder ID" nützt mir also nichts, da ich ja keine Wahl habe.

Wieso nicht?

{cms_selflink page='ID'} sollte dir eigentlich die komplette SEO bzw. CMS generierte URL ausgeben.

Oder hab ich da etwas falsch verstanden?

Offline

#6 03. Mai 2019 15:09

antibart
Server-Pate
Registriert: 14. Dezember 2010
Beiträge: 880

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

cyberman schrieb:

Oder hab ich da etwas falsch verstanden?

Ich dachte, es wäre so gemeint, dass man beim Paramater page nicht ID oder alias eingibt, sondern den bestimmten alias/ID

{cms_selflink page='5'}

bzw

{cms_selflink page='home'}

...aber ich probier es mal.

Beitrag geändert von antibart (03. Mai 2019 15:11)

Offline

#7 03. Mai 2019 15:51

antibart
Server-Pate
Registriert: 14. Dezember 2010
Beiträge: 880

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

Es hat die ganze Zeit nicht funktioniert, weil ich ...

[== html ==]
<a href="{cms_selflink href='{$item->fielddefs.aim.value}' page='alias'}">dfsd</a>

... den Tag für die Felddefinition in Tüdelchen gesetzt habe.

Ohne geht es. Ich bin beeindruckt.

Danke smile smile

Beitrag geändert von antibart (03. Mai 2019 15:58)

Offline

#8 04. Mai 2019 22:46

nockenfell
Moderator
Ort: Gontenschwil, Schweiz
Registriert: 09. November 2010
Beiträge: 2.934
Webseite

Re: [GELÖST] LISE - Inhaltsseiten: ID auf alias umleiten

+1  smile


[dieser Beitrag wurde mit 100% recycled bits geschrieben]
Mein Blog  /   Diverse Links rund um CMS Made Simple
Module: btAdminer, ToolBox

Offline